Passerini multicomponent reaction of protected α-aminoaldehydes as a tool for combinatorial synthesis of enzyme inhibitors

Three-component Passerini condensation of N-Boc-α-aminoaldehydes with various isocyanides and carboxylic acids leads, after Boc-deprotection/transacylation, to complex peptide-like structures containing an α-hydroxy-β-aminoacid unit or, after oxidation, an α-oxo-β-aminoacid unit.
